
Iron has shaped human civilization for millennia, yet its story begins long before the first furnace was lit. This presentation traces the natural history of iron from its cosmic origins to its earliest metallurgical use. Beginning with the formation of the elements in the cosmos and their journey through stardust, we follow iron through the astronomical, geological, and environmental processes that concentrated iron into ores accessible to humans.
Along the way, we explore meteorites, banded iron formations, bog iron, and the remarkable geochemical cycling of iron in soils, wetlands, and groundwater systems. From sulfides to oxides, the iron cycle is driven by redox reactions that govern its movement, accumulation, and transformation.
The first iron smelters learned to harness these processes, enabling practical iron and steel production and the technologies that followed.
Speaker: Dr. Barret Wessel
Dr. Barret Wessel is an Assistant Professor of Soil Science in the Department of Plant, Soil and Microbial Sciences at Michigan State University, where he teaches introductory and advanced courses in soil and environmental science.
His research focuses on soil formation, wetland and subaqueous soils, and the science of teaching and learning. He holds a Ph.D. in Environmental Science and Technology with a concentration in Soil and Watershed Science, and a Graduate Certificate in Historic Preservation, from the University of Maryland.
